use crate::logging::Rating;
#[derive(Debug, Clone, Default)]
pub struct QueryBuilder {
conditions: Vec<String>,
params: Vec<String>,
}
impl QueryBuilder {
#[must_use]
pub fn new() -> Self {
Self {
conditions: Vec::new(),
params: Vec::new(),
}
}
#[must_use]
pub fn with_name(mut self, name: impl Into<String>) -> Self {
self.conditions.push("name LIKE ?".to_string());
self.params.push(format!("%{}%", name.into()));
self
}
#[must_use]
pub fn with_rating(mut self, rating: Rating) -> Self {
self.conditions.push("rating = ?".to_string());
self.params.push(rating.to_value().to_string());
self
}
#[must_use]
pub fn with_min_rating(mut self, rating: Rating) -> Self {
self.conditions.push("rating >= ?".to_string());
self.params.push(rating.to_value().to_string());
self
}
#[must_use]
pub fn with_favorite(mut self, is_favorite: bool) -> Self {
self.conditions
.push(format!("is_favorite = {}", i64::from(is_favorite)));
self
}
#[must_use]
pub fn with_rejected(mut self, is_rejected: bool) -> Self {
self.conditions
.push(format!("is_rejected = {}", i64::from(is_rejected)));
self
}
#[must_use]
pub fn build(&self) -> String {
let mut query = String::from("SELECT * FROM clips");
if !self.conditions.is_empty() {
query.push_str(" WHERE ");
query.push_str(&self.conditions.join(" AND "));
}
query.push_str(" ORDER BY created_at DESC");
query
}
#[must_use]
pub fn params(&self) -> &[String] {
&self.params
}
}
